| public void testDisableLogOverWS() throws Exception { |
| Properties props = new Properties(); |
| // Test missing logfile |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.File", ""); |
| File propsFile = new File(getTestCaseConfDir(), "test-disable-log-over-ws-log4j.properties"); |
| FileOutputStream f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| setSystemProperty(XLogService.LOG4J_FILE, propsFile.getName()); |
| assertTrue(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test non-absolute path for logfile |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.File", "oozie.log");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ertTrue(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test missing appender class |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.File", "${oozie.log.dir}/oozie.log"); |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ie", "");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ertTrue(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test appender class not DailyRollingFileAppender or RollingFileAppender |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ie", "org.blah.blah");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ertTrue(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test DailyRollingFileAppender but missing DatePattern |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ie", "org.apache.log4j.DailyRollingFileAppender"); |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.DatePattern", "");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ertTrue(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test DailyRollingFileAppender but DatePattern that doesn't end with 'HH' or 'dd' |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.DatePattern", "'.'yyyy-MM");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ertTrue(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test DailyRollingFileAppender with everything correct (dd) |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.DatePattern", "'.'yyyy-MM-dd");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ertFalse(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test DailyRollingFileAppender with everything correct (HH) |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.DatePattern", "'.'yyyy-MM-dd-HH");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ertFalse(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test RollingFileAppender but missing FileNamePattern |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ie", "org.apache.log4j.rolling.RollingFileAppender"); |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.RollingPolicy.FileNamePattern", "");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ertTrue(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test RollingFileAppender but FileNamePattern with incorrect ending |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.RollingPolicy.FileNamePattern", "${oozie.log.dir}/oozie.log-blah");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ertTrue(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test RollingFileAppender but FileNamePattern with incorrect beginning |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.RollingPolicy.FileNamePattern", "${oozie.log.dir}/blah.log-%d{yyyy-MM-dd-HH}");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ertTrue(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test RollingFileAppender with everything correct |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.RollingPolicy.FileNamePattern", "${oozie.log.dir}/oozie.log-%d{yyyy-MM-dd-HH}");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ertFalse(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| |
| // Test RollingFileAppender with everything correct (gz) |
| props.setProperty("log4j.appender.oozie.RollingPolicy.FileNamePattern", "${oozie.log.dir}/oozie.log-%d{yyyy-MM-dd-HH}.gz"); |
| fos = new FileOutputStream(propsFile); |
| props.store(fos, ""); |
| assertFalse(doStreamDisabledCheck()); |
| } |
